You got the email, you're confused, let's break it downSo Tailwind sent out an email about something called an MCP server, and if you read it and thought "what does that even mean," you're not alone. Let's break it down simply. MCP stands for Model Context Protocol. Think of it as a translator between AI assistants, like Claude or ChatGPT, and the software you already use. Before this, if you wanted an AI to help with a task, you'd copy information out of one app, paste it into your AI chat, get a response, then copy that back into the other app. Clunky. MCP removes that step. It lets your AI assistant talk directly to Tailwind and actually do things inside it. So now, instead of opening the Tailwind dashboard, you can tell your AI assistant to schedule a Pin, and it happens. That's what the email was announcing.Does this fit into your existing workflow, and is it even necessary?Here's the question I'd actually ask if I got that email. If you're already using Tailwind to schedule, does this save you time? Fair question, because scheduling itself isn't really the bottleneck Tailwind already solves. The real time savings comes from cutting out the handoff between drafting your content and publishing it. Right now your workflow could look like this. You draft your pin copy somewhere, then you go open Tailwind, upload the image, paste in the title and description, pick the board, hit schedule. That's two tools and at least one copy-paste step. With MCP, drafting and scheduling happen in the same conversation. You write the pin copy with your AI, and it just does that last step for you. One less tool, one less switch.But I'll be honest with you. If you're just batch pinning of pre-made images with no copy to write, Tailwind's own scheduler is already fast, and this won't feel meaningfully different. It shines when content creation and scheduling are two separate steps you're doing back to back. This collapses them into one. So is it necessary? No. Is it useful if your workflow already starts with writing? Yes.How to leverage AI for your Pinterest marketingIf you're going to use AI for Pinterest at all, the highest value spot isn't the scheduling piece, it's the content piece. Use it to draft pin titles and descriptions, brainstorm keyword variations, repurpose a blog post or podcast episode into pin copy, or review what you already have scheduled and catch gaps. The AI is most useful the moment before something needs to be written, not the moment it needs to be clicked.A few questions to ask yourself before you adopt thisBefore you add any new tool or integration to your workflow, ask yourself these:Does this remove a step I'm already doing, or does it just add a new thing to learn?Is my current bottleneck actually scheduling, or is it content creation?Will I actually use this weekly, or is it a shiny new feature I'll try once and forget?Does this fit how my team already works, or does it require retraining everyone?If you can't answer yes to at least one of those in a way that saves you real time, it's fine to let this one sit for now. Avoidance doesn't always look like silence, shutting down, or refusing to communicate. In fact, you can be highly verbal, expressive, and even confrontational—and still be avoiding the conversations that actually matter. In this episode, we're unpacking the sneaky ways avoidance shows up in relationships, from people pleasing and hyper-independence to criticism, passive aggressiveness, bickering, and numbing out.We're also getting personal about the ways we've recognized these patterns in our own lives and relationships. If you've ever thought, “It's not worth bringing up,” waited until resentment exploded, expected someone to read your mind, or convinced yourself you're just better off handling everything alone, this conversation is for you. An eating disorder is often a coping strategy for deeper distress. It can be a way to gain a glimmer of self-esteem, when you don't feel good enough. It can be a way to find a sense of control, when life feels uncontrollable. It can be a way to numb and distract from difficult emotions. It can become part of an identity as the thin or healthy person. It can be a way to communicate, when it is difficult to communicate through words. The roar of waterfall sounds for sleeping can be one of the most effective nature sounds for masking out outside noises that keep you awake at night. Whether you live next to a busy street, a noisy neighbor, or have a roommate that listens to TV a little too loud, the constant sound of a waterfall can help your mind stay relaxed. Listening to waterfall sounds to sleep can also ease your body as you fall asleep, making you feel better prepared for bed. Śrīmad-Bhāgavatam says that when you control the tongue, then all the other senses become controlled after that. Then, by that practice of chanting Hare Krishna, you will come to a point where it tastes good and you don't want to stop, and then automatically—systemically—you'll feel satisfied. All the senses become satisfied when you please Krishna by chanting with your tongue: jihvā ādau—first thing, the tongue. And toleration. We do various kinds of duties, and we also do austerities, and in those things you have to learn the art of toleration. Krishna mentions that in the Bhagavad-gītā in many different places, but it serves us well. I'll tell you how to do it. It's called "Tender Loving Neglect." So, there's a way in which there are urges that come up, agitations. You don't say, "No, get out of here, never ever come back!" You just say, "Yeah, I know you're there. I'll get to you later. For now, I'm not going to do anything." As Haridāsa Ṭhākura did—when a prostitute came, he didn't say, "Scram!" He said, "I'll be with you in a minute, I've got to finish my rounds." We know how to put things off. If you've ever had an important paper to write, and then you kept doing everything else—you washed your whole room, you figured out a formula for creating more efficient gasoline, whatever you might do to avoid writing the paper—that's procrastination. Do the same thing when there are sense urges: neglect them. "Fundraising is distracting and draining. How do I cope?"Dave sent this to the Peer Effect Post Bag. And James and Freddie's answer challenges the question itself.If fundraising is your responsibility as a founder, calling it a "distraction" reveals the problem. That framing guarantees you'll feel distracted during it, which means you won't perform as well as you could.This is Season 6 of Post Bag. James and Freddie are founder coaches who've worked with dozens of scale-ups through fundraising cycles.The insight:If you see fundraising as a distraction from "real work," you'll feel distracted. Reframe it as your number one priority for that period - and everything changes.Fundraising isn't something you do to enable the business. When you're in it, it IS the business. Securing funding is what lets you hire, scale, make payroll, do everything you say you want to do.What you'll hear:Why each investor conversation should be a learning opportunity (what landed, what didn't, what questions you answered well, what to improve)The founder who hates fundraising but crushes it every time, because she treats it as her one thingThe "is it you or your team" question: If you say it's the team, it's probably you. If you say it's you, it's probably the team.Why you need a team that can survive without you, because if you're fundraising every 2 years for 3-6 months, you're spending 25% of your time away from the businessHow to know if you've made yourself the bottleneckWhy "you're the prize" changes the power dynamic (it's a two-way process, not begging)What to focus on beyond the outcome: connections, learning, communication skills, and understanding what you want in an investorThe reality check:Fundraising is brutal for the ego. It's humbling. People pick apart your baby. Half-listen. Don't respond to follow-ups. But if you give it your all, treat it as your priority, and learn from every conversation, you'll be successful even if you don't enjoy it.And if you describe yourself as chaotic or ADHD, knowing your #1 priority becomes even more essential. A single 30-second Super Bowl spot now costs $8 million. Factor in production, celebrities, and amplification, and total campaign costs land between $15 and $50 million. So, are the ads actually worth it?Elena, Angela, and Rob break down this year's Super Bowl commercials through a marketing effectiveness lens. You're getting distracted and you don't even know it. Your attention gets grabbed, you become interested, and suddenly you're doing things that weren't on your plan. I'm going to walk you through two advertising principles that explain exactly how this happens. One shows how your mind naturally works. The other shows where you are right now. Understanding these will change how you move through your day. You'll see why you drift off course and how to use your own brain to stay focused on what actually matters. Featured Story The other day I was driving and the red lights came on my dash. Temperature dropped to 31 degrees here in Florida. I became acutely aware that I had a problem. Low tire pressure. So now I'm thinking about where to get free air. Because free air is hard to find these days. But I know one place that has it. That's the whole process right there. I went from completely unaware to taking action because I understood exactly where I was in the awareness stages. Important Points Your attention gets grabbed all day long by bosses, friends, and advertisers using the AIDA model—they get your attention, build your interest, create desire, and move you to action before you realize what happened. You can be in one of five awareness stages right now: completely unaware of your problem, aware something's wrong, looking for solutions, knowing which product or person can help, or actively implementing solutions across your whole life. The same mental process that distracts you can work for your benefit when you deliberately use it to grab your own attention and stay interested in what moves you toward your big-ass goal. Every year designers obsess over the same recycled “Logo Design Trends” and every year companies panic, rebrand, and burn piles of money trying to look relevant. Here's the truth no trend report will ever tell you. Trends aren't the future of logo design. They're a giant red flag that a brand is confused, inconsistent, or unwilling to fix the real problems underneath.And here's the part most graphic designers will hate. The only reason trends keep winning is because too many designers keep thinking trends equal good design. Most of us would make the exact same mistakes these companies do because we chase aesthetics instead of understanding strategy. Most designers follow. Only a few actually design.
